Systech and EchoSat Partner to Offer Satellite-Based IP Payment Solution

Monday 15 March 2004 16:52 CET | News

Systech has partnered with EchoSat to deploy Systech Internet Payment Gateways to convert dial-up payment transactions to faster, IP-based transactions over EchoSat satellite networks.

Under the agreement, EchoSat will re-market Systech dial to IP conversion gateways to EchoSat merchants as part of a turnkey solution. Systech Internet Payment Gateways convert dial-up payment transactions to high-speed IP transactions. The gateways connect POS payment terminals, POS payment controllers and ATMs to the EchoSat network. The EchoSat network transports the transactions to the EchoSat HUB, and then forwards them via a secure Internet connection to the merchants payment processor of choice. The Systech/EchoSat IP transactions adhere to industry-standard SSL encryption specifications. Merchants benefit from both higher-speed transactions and recurring cost savings from eliminating dedicated dial-up telephone lines.
